Sedimentary rocks are only a thin layer (veneer) over a crust consisting mainly of igneous and metamorphic rock.
• Sedimentary rocks are deposited in layers as strata, forming a structure called bedding. Sedimentary rocks are often deposited in large structure called sedimentary basins.
• It is also known as aqueous rock and stratified rock.
